When an On-Site Sewage Facility (OSSF) is neglected in the Bonita Springs area, the localized consequences are distinct and hazardous:
- Estero Bay & Gulf Contamination: Properties located near the coast, the Imperial River, or local canals are under intense environmental scrutiny. A saturated, overflowing septic tank releases raw human pathogens and high nitrogen loads directly through the porous sand into the waterways. This threatens marine life, manatee habitats, and contributes to toxic red tide algae blooms.
- High Water Table Hydraulic Lock: During Florida’s intense summer thunderstorms or Gulf hurricanes, the sandy soil saturates rapidly and the Imperial River frequently swells. If a septic tank is full of solid sludge, the high groundwater leaves the effluent nowhere to drain, causing raw sewage to instantly back up into the home.
- Salt-Air Corrosion: For coastal properties, the highly corrosive salt-air environment and brackish groundwater aggressively accelerate the degradation of concrete tank lids, metal baffles, and aerobic compressor parts, leading to premature structural failures.
- Storm Surge Washouts: Low-lying coastal drain fields can be physically washed out or completely saturated with saltwater during a hurricane surge, killing the essential bacteria in the system and causing total bio-mechanical failure.
To protect the Lee County ecosystem, property owners must enforce uncompromising maintenance protocols:
- Strict Pumping Intervals: Schedule a professional vacuum pump-out every 3 to 5 years (or more frequently for active rentals). Aging systems in high-water-table areas cannot forgive any solid sludge escaping into the lateral lines.
- Protect the Biomat: Never allow heavy landscaping trucks or pool construction equipment to cross the hidden drain field or elevated mound, as the wet coastal sand offers little structural protection for the pipes.
- Storm Preparation: Pumping your tank *before* hurricane season is critical to provide emergency holding capacity when the power goes out and the drain field is hydraulically locked by groundwater.

Septic Tank Regulations in Bonita Springs, FL (Lee County)
Bonita Springs is located within Lee County, Florida. The primary regulatory framework governing Onsite Sewage Treatment and Disposal Systems (OSTDS), which include septic tanks, throughout Florida is the Florida Administrative Code (F.A.C.) Chapter 64E-6, titled "Standards for Onsite Sewage Treatment and Disposal Systems." This comprehensive chapter dictates everything from site evaluation and system design to installation, repair, abandonment, and maintenance.
Key regulatory aspects under F.A.C. 64E-6 relevant to Bonita Springs include:
- Permitting Requirements: No OSTDS can be installed, repaired, modified, or abandoned without a permit issued by the local health department.
- Site Evaluation: Prior to permit issuance, a detailed site evaluation is required, which typically includes soil borings or percolation tests to determine soil characteristics, water table elevation, and suitability for a drainfield.
- System Sizing and Design: The size of the septic tank and the drainfield area are determined based on the number of bedrooms in the residence and the soil's hydraulic conductivity (drainage capacity). For a typical 3-bedroom home, minimum daily flow is estimated at 240 gallons per day.
- Setback Requirements: Strict setback distances are enforced to protect public health and the environment. These include minimum distances from:
- Potable water wells (75 feet for drainfield, 50 feet for tank).
- Surface water bodies (75 feet for drainfield).
- Property lines (10 feet for drainfield, 5 feet for tank).
- Buildings, storm sewers, and public drinking water lines.
- Vertical Separation: A crucial regulation in low-lying areas like Bonita Springs is the requirement for adequate vertical separation between the bottom of the drainfield and the wet season high water table or an impermeable soil layer. F.A.C. 64E-6 mandates at least 24 inches of unsaturated soil. When this cannot be achieved naturally, alternative designs such as elevated drainfields (mound systems) or aerobic treatment units (ATUs) combined with a reduced drainfield may be required.
- Treatment Standards: Conventional septic tanks provide primary treatment. In areas with environmental sensitivities, high water tables, or limited space, advanced secondary treatment may be mandated through performance-based treatment systems (PBTS), which often involve ATUs to further treat wastewater before it reaches the drainfield.
Typical Soil Drainage Characteristics in Bonita Springs
The soils in Bonita Springs, characteristic of Southwest Florida's coastal plain, are predominantly sandy, poorly drained, and often exhibit a high water table. Specifically, you will typically encounter:
- Sandy Soils: The upper soil layers are generally composed of fine sands, offering good permeability when dry.
- Shallow Water Table: Due to the low elevation and proximity to the coast, the water table is frequently shallow, especially during the wet season (June through October). This is the most significant factor dictating septic system design in the area.
- Spodic Horizon (Hardpan): Beneath the sandy topsoil, it's common to find a spodic horizon, also known as "hardpan," which is a restrictive layer that can impede water movement and exacerbate high water table issues.
These soil characteristics profoundly dictate drainfield design:
- Elevated Drainfields (Mound Systems): Given the shallow water table and often insufficient natural vertical separation, many properties in Bonita Springs require elevated or mound drainfields. These systems create an artificial soil treatment area above the natural grade, using imported fill material to achieve the necessary separation to the water table.
- Larger Drainfield Footprints: Even with sandy soils, if the seasonal high water table is close to the surface, the effective depth for treatment is reduced, often necessitating a larger drainfield area to compensate.
- Performance-Based Treatment Systems (PBTS) with Aerobic Treatment Units (ATUs): When vertical separation is severely limited, or if the property is in a nutrient-sensitive area (such as near estuaries or bays), ATUs are frequently mandated. These systems biologically treat wastewater to a higher standard before it enters a smaller, often elevated, drainfield. This reduces the nutrient load and reliance on natural soil attenuation.
Local Permitting Authority for Bonita Springs
For all residential septic system permitting, inspections, and regulatory compliance in Bonita Springs, the local permitting authority is the Florida Department of Health in Lee County.
You would contact their Environmental Health Services section for:
- New septic system construction permits.
- Repair or modification permits for existing systems.
- System abandonment permits.
- Site evaluations and soil suitability assessments.
- Inspections during various phases of installation and final approval.
- Complaint investigations regarding failing septic systems.
They are responsible for ensuring that all OSTDS in Lee County comply with F.A.C. Chapter 64E-6 and any other applicable state or local regulations.
